The State of Connecticut, Secretary of State (SOTS) is recruiting for a State Program Manager. The ideal candidate for this position thrives in a collaborative environment and is committed to delivering exceptional administrative and fiscal support in service of the agency's mission. This is a full-time, 40-hour per week position, Monday through Friday, located in Hartford, CT. The role involves the administration of federal, state, and local elections, implementation of election procedures, practices, and new legislation. The candidate will be responsible for implementing new programs, procedures, and practices from conception through legislation, election day, and beyond. They should be comfortable handling difficult situations with professionalism, able to reach diverse populations, and possess strong communication skills to represent the agency. A passion for promoting participation in the democratic process and experience in project/program management and election administration are key. The Office of the Secretary of the State provides a wide range of services for the people and businesses of Connecticut, acting as a repository of records and providing information on business filings, elections, and authentication. The Legislation and Elections Administration Division (LEAD) specifically administers, interprets, and implements all state and federal laws pertaining to elections, primaries, nominating procedures, and voting rights, while also serving as the official keeper of legislative documents and administering Connecticut's notary public program.
